Special Teams Impact

Often overlooked, special teams can have a significant impact on the game's outcome. Kickoffs, punts, field goals, and extra points can all influence the score and field position. A long kickoff return, a perfectly executed punt that pins the opponent deep in their own territory, or a clutch field goal can change the course of the game. Special teams plays require precision and teamwork, and when executed well, they can provide a crucial edge. Running Back Impact

Running backs play a crucial role in the offense by providing a ground attack and taking pressure off the quarterback. A running back who can consistently gain yardage, break tackles, and score touchdowns can significantly impact the game. Evaluating a running back's performance involves looking at their rushing stats, yards per carry, and ability to make key plays in crucial situations. A dominant running game can control the clock, wear down the defense, and help the team secure a win.

Wide Receiver Contributions

Wide receivers are essential for the passing game, and their ability to catch passes, gain yards, and score touchdowns is vital to the offense. A receiver who can make contested catches, run precise routes, and create separation from defenders can significantly impact the game. Evaluating a receiver's performance involves looking at their receiving stats, yards after catch, and ability to make key plays in the red zone. A strong performance from the wide receivers can open up the passing game and create scoring opportunities.
